Abstract
1,185,483. Rotary positive-displacement pumps; jet pumps. ROBERT BOSCH G. m.b.H. June 7, 1967 [June 18, 1966], No.26258/67. Headings F1E and F1F. In a rotary positive-displacement hydraulic pump the rate of flow of working fluid in an outlet bore 38 is controlled, and cavitation in spaces between a vaned rotor 29 and abutment ring 12 obviated, by a proportion of the fluid in a passage 37 being drawn through a bye-pass bore 40 into a diffuser by incoming fluid issuing from a tubular member 47 on a spring-loaded piston 49, the diffuser including a conic bore 50, a bore 51 and divergent passages, or branches, 52, 53 communicating at their ends 54, 55 with said spaces between outlet passages 34, 35, which are connected to the passage 37 by an annular chamber 36. When the speed of the rotor is relatively low, the tubular member abuts a ring 57 to prevent flow through the bore 40; and, by virtue of an orifice 43 at the entrance to the bore 38 and a channel 44 transmitting pressure in the last said bore to the upper side of the piston, when the speed of the rotor is sufficiently great the piston is raised to initiate flow in the bye-pass bore. If the pressure in the bore 38 becomes excessive, a spring-loaded valve 60 opens to increase the flow through the bore 51 and hence that through the bore 40 also. A Venturi D is included in the bore 40 (not shown in Fig.1) to ensure a substantially constant flow-rate in the bore 38 despite variations in the speed of the rotor. A bearing body 16 for a driving shaft 22 is axially movable and loaded by pressure in the chamber 36.
